Yes Number of books, serial backfiles, and other material including government documents: 117,340 Number of current serial subscriptions: 366 Number of microforms: 136,386 Number of audiovisuals: Number of ebooks: 24,882 Other library facilities: The Abbot Vincent Taylor Library has a well-known rare books collection comprising over 7,000 manuscripts, incunabula, and books dating from 1474 to 1900.
